WASHINGTON, March 16 -- Sen. Shelley Moore Capito issued the following press release:

Today, U.S. Senator Shelley Moore Capito (R-W.Va.), a member of the Senate Commerce, Science, and Transportation Subcommittee on Aviation, Space, and Innovation, visited the Katherine Johnson Independent and Validation (IV&V) Facility in Fairmont, W.Va. with NASA Administrator Jared Isaacman.

"West Virginia has played a critical role in America's leadership in space, and seeing the incredible work being done at NASA's Goddard Space Flight Center and the Katherine Johnson IV&V Facility today only reinforces that legacy," Senator Capito said.
